Xiaohui Bai is a scholar working on Mechanical Engineering, Computational Mechanics and Biomedical Engineering. According to data from OpenAlex, Xiaohui Bai has authored 47 papers receiving a total of 524 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Mechanical Engineering, 21 papers in Computational Mechanics and 18 papers in Biomedical Engineering. Recurrent topics in Xiaohui Bai’s work include Heat and Mass Transfer in Porous Media (17 papers), Nanofluid Flow and Heat Transfer (13 papers) and Heat Transfer and Optimization (8 papers). Xiaohui Bai is often cited by papers focused on Heat and Mass Transfer in Porous Media (17 papers), Nanofluid Flow and Heat Transfer (13 papers) and Heat Transfer and Optimization (8 papers). Xiaohui Bai collaborates with scholars based in China, Japan and United Kingdom. Xiaohui Bai's co-authors include Akira Nakayama, Zihao Zheng, Yoshihiko Sano, Cunliang Liu, Fujio Kuwahara, Yi Yuan, Moghtada Mobedi, Fengfeng Zhu, Dandan Guan and M. Yao and has published in prestigious journals such as Physical Review B, The Journal of Physical Chemistry C and Journal of Controlled Release.
